What Is a LinkedIn Carousel Maker?

A LinkedIn carousel maker is a tool that creates the multi-slide document posts that appear as swipeable content in the LinkedIn feed. LinkedIn renders these as PDF document posts — readers swipe or click through multiple slides, each containing a piece of your content. The format drives significantly higher engagement than text posts because it keeps readers actively interacting rather than passively scrolling past.

LinkedIn removed the old native "carousel" feature in 2023 and replaced it with document posts — the format is the same experience for the reader; the upload method changed. Document posts (carousels) in 2023 generated 2.5x more engagement than standard posts, and that gap has held consistently since. The challenge: creating them manually is time-consuming. Why LinkedIn Carousels Drive More Engagement Than Text Posts

LinkedIn carousels outperform text posts for three structural reasons that are consistent across platform research:

Dwell time signals

LinkedIn's algorithm measures how long users spend on your post. A 10-slide carousel keeps a reader engaged significantly longer than a text post containing the same information — and the algorithm rewards that time investment with broader distribution. A reader who swipes through all 10 slides generates a strong positive signal.

Active interaction

Swiping through slides is an active engagement signal. LinkedIn's algorithm weighs active interactions — swipes, clicks, saves — more heavily than passive ones like impressions. Carousels generate more interaction signals per view than any other content format.

Save rate

Carousels are saved at a higher rate than text posts because readers want to return to the information later. Saves are one of LinkedIn's strongest positive distribution signals — a post with high save rate gets pushed to additional audience segments automatically.

How many slides should a LinkedIn carousel have?

LinkedIn carousels perform best with 5–10 slides. Fewer than 5 slides often don't justify the swipe interaction for readers. More than 12 slides typically see engagement drop on the final slides as readers abandon before the end.
